Comparing fail-safe microcontroller architectures in light of IEC 61508

In this paper, an overview is given on the main architectures used in the automotive to implement fail-safe microcontrollers. The concept of a new HW-centric, distributed and optimized architecture is also presented. In light of the IEC 61508 norm for safety related electronic systems, a comparisons between these different architectures is done based on a reference design. The paper concludes discussing how the presented architectures can be extended to become fail-functional.
